    Window Glass Replacement Near Me

    If you're in need of replacing your window glass, you will want to find a business that can handle the task for you. There are numerous options, but a professional will give you the best value.

    Replacement-Doors-300x200.jpgDouble-paned glass windows are more durable than single-paned glass windows.

    A double pane window is a type of window that contains two glass panes that are separated by air. They are more efficient than single-paned windows and provide greater insulation for your home. If you're thinking of building an entirely new house, or replacing your old windows and want to know the advantages of double-paned windows.

    Double-pane windows are more durable and economical than single-pane windows. This makes them an attractive choice for homeowners who want to improve their home's insulation and increase the value of their home's resales. They also reduce the cost of energy especially when equipped with gas insulation.

    If you are installing double-paned windows it is essential to ensure that they are properly sealed. This will keep the inside of your house warmer and will also prevent mold and other mildew problems. Having a solid frame can to improve the overall performance of your windows.

    The R-value, or amount of energy that windows offer in comparison to another window and is determined by the size and thickness of the glass. In comparison to single paned windows double-paned windows can help save you up to 24 percent in colder climates and 18 percent in hotter climates.

    The main benefit of double-paned windows lies in their ability to keep your home warm in the winter months. This is mainly due to the sandwich of air between the two glass panes, which acts as a shock absorber. This can help reduce light transmission through your windows during the summer heat.

    Double-paned windows can be costly despite their many advantages. They can cost between $100 and $300 per window. They are well worth the expense if you can save time and money over time.

    Insulated windows are better than regular windows

    Insulate windows are a great way to protect your home from the elements. They also improve your homes insulating performance and help you control temperature. Window insulation that is efficient can help you save money on costs for energy and stop condensation from building up on your windows.

    There are a variety of types of insulating materials available for your home There are some that stand out as most suited for your needs. These include composite windows frames that are double and single pane windows, and insulation panels.

    The most effective type of insulating material is one that is resistant to the flow of heat. In most cases, it is a composite frame that is made of polymer plastic. These frames are more durable than traditional wood frames and require less maintenance.

    Window frames can also be constructed of fiberglass or vinyl. These materials are excellent for insulation, but aren't as strong as wooden frames. You may want to consider windows with impact-resistant frames for those who live in a region that is prone to hurricanes.

    Another important factor in window insulation is the R-value. The R-value is a measure of the window's thermal resistance. Higher R-values mean better insulation.

    A triple-pane glass is another kind of window that improves its insulation efficiency. This window features three glass panes that are separated by spacers. It's much more insulated than a single pane of glass.

    A triple-paned window offers greater protection against break-ins. If one pane fails the other two continue to work.

    A warm-edge spacer is among the best methods to insulate windows. This spacer keeps the glass panes at a perfect distance from each other which prevents condensation.

    Single-paned floating is the most affordable type to replace.

    If you need replacement for your window glass in the near future, you'll be glad to know that there are many kinds of glass you can choose from. The kind of glass you select can make a difference in the cost you pay and the quality of the glass. It also has a huge impact on your energy efficiency.

    There are six types of glass you can choose from. There are six kinds of glass such as safety, laminated reinforced, double pane, and triple pane. All of them are offered at various prices, features and applications.

    Single-pane floating glass is the cheapest window glass to replace, but it's also the most vulnerable. It is easy to break. For larger windows it may be necessary to have reinforced or tempered glass.

    Tempered glass is broken into smaller cubes, which reduces the risk of injuries. Tempered glass window replacement is also stronger than other kinds of glass. However, it can be dangerous in the event of a break.

    Safety laminated glass is generally the best option for commercial buildings. It is safe from breaking through the use of wires. This type of glass is typically found in schools.

    Triple pane glass consists of three layers of glass, offering excellent insulation in harsh climates. To improve efficiency, many experts suggest applying a reflective low-E coating to your windows.

    Low-E glass windows don't just provide insulation to your home, but also block UV radiation. They are great for windows facing west.

    Double pane glass is more energy efficiency and is more soundproof than single-pane glass. A coating with low-E will cut down on the UV rays up to 70%. The glass's energy efficiency will be enhanced by adding Krypton or argon gas between the panes.

    Measurement of a double-glazed windows

    To ensure that your double-glazed windows can fit in your home, you will need to be precise in measuring. A good measurement can save you time and money. If you're planning to replace windows that are old and doors, making sure you measure correctly will ensure that you receive a better-fitting replacement sealed glass units.

    First, you must measure the height and width of your windows. You'll need a measuring tape as well as a notepad to record your measurements. The measurement from the jamb to the sill is an ideal way to do it. For windows with bow or bay windows, a ruler or angle finder is very useful.

    You'll also have to measure the width and height of the window frame. This is the height and width at the edge that is outside of the window. To allow for fitting allowances you'll need to subtract 10mm.

    Next, determine the distance between the glass and straight edge. You'll want to measure this twice. If you have a spacer, you'll have to add 6 millimeters to the total.

    After you've measured your space, you'll need to know how much of a difference you can expect from a double-glazed unit. A supplier can give you an estimate of the measurements you've taken.

    Double-glazed units can be slightly more costly than single-glazed ones, but they're worth it. They can boost the value of your house and provide greater energy efficiency. However, if the windows have been damaged, you'll have to replace windows.

    Making sure you measure properly is the best way to determine the degree to which your window will perform. Incorrect measurements can lead to poor performance, which could result in costly repairs.

    For the job, get an expert

    You might consider hiring a professional if you need to replace or repair your windows. These professionals can streamline the process. This will save you time and money.

    It is recommended to get multiple estimates before you hire an expert. Also, you should consider the reputation of the company. This will help you avoid costly mistakes that could affect the performance or aesthetics of your windows.

    You can be sure that your glass will be properly installed If you choose to work with a professional. A reputable window company will also offer a guarantee on their work.

    Employing a professional to handle window glass replacement is essential since a damaged window could be dangerous. A damaged window could make it easier for burglars to break in and take your property. A jammed or cracked lock can be a security threat as well.

    Professional window installers can complete the job in just one day. They have established relationships with suppliers and are able to provide lower rates. Many contractors will also provide you a free estimate.

    Professionals can install windows of a variety of styles. They will make use of high-quality materials and top-of-the-line equipment to ensure that your windows are repaired.

    Glass is a delicate material and is susceptible to wear and tear. If it isn't taken care of, it can be a danger to pets and children.

    Window glass replacement sealed glass units and repair costs vary depending on the type of window as well as the number of damaged panes. Prices are usually between $100 and $500, not including the cost of the glass.

    Although inexpensive materials might appear appealing, they can be difficult to maintain. Incorrect installation can cause air leaks, which could lower energy efficiency.
